1-Bit to 4-Bit Address/Driver
with 3-State Outputs
Product Features
• PI74ALVCH16344 is designed for low voltage operation
• VCC = 2.3V to 3.6V
• Hysteresis on all inputs
• Typical VOLP (Output Ground Bounce)
< 0.8V at VCC = 3.3V, TA = 25°C
• Typical VOHV (Output VOH Undershoot)
< 2.0V at VCC = 3.3V, TA = 25°C
• Bus Hold retains last active bus state during 3-State,
eliminating the need for external pullup resistors
• Industrial operation at –40°C to +85°C
• Packages available:
– 56-pin 240 mil wide plastic TSSOP (A)
– 56-pin 300 mil wide plastic SSOP (V)
Product Description
Pericom Semiconductor’s PI74ALVCH series of logic circuits are
produced in the Company’s advanced 0.5 micron CMOS technology,
achieving industry leading speed.
The PI74ALVCH16344 is a 1-bit to 4-bit buffer/driver designed for
2.3V to 3.6V Vcc operation.
The address/driver is designed for applications where four seperate
memory locations must be addressed by a single address.
To ensure the high-impedance state during power up or power down,
OE should be tied to VCC through a pullup resistor; the minimum
value of the resistor is determined by the current-sinking capability
of the driver.
The PI74ALVCH16344 has “Bus Hold” which retains the data
input’s last state whenever the data input goes to high-impedance
preventing “floating” inputs and eliminating the need for pullup/
down resistors.
